Abstract

[Abstract]: We introduce a new class of anticipative backward stochastic differential equations with a dependence of McKean type on the law of the solution, that we name MKABSDE. We provide existence and uniqueness results in a general framework with relatively general regularity assumptions on the coefficients. We show how such stochastic equations arise within the modern paradigm of derivative pricing where a central counterparty (CCP) requires the members to deposit variation and initial margins to cover their exposure. In the case when the initial margin is proportional to the Conditional Value-at-Risk (CVaR) of the contract price, we apply our general result to define the price as a solution of a MKABSDE. We provide several linear and non-linear simpler approximations, which we solve using different numerical (deterministic and Monte-Carlo) methods.
